A10 Networks, Inc. engages in the provision of networking solutions. It offers security, hybrid cloud, service providers, vertical solutions, and mobile carriers. It operates through the following geographical segments: Americas, Asia-Pacific and Japan (APJ), and Europe, the Middle East, and Africa (EMEA). The Americas segment includes all other countries in the Americas, excluding the Unites States. The APJ segment is involved in all countries in the Asia Pacific region including Japan. The company was founded by Lee Chen in 2004 and is headquartered in San Jose, CA.
